Supposedly a first gen should pull 12.05 @115 mph at a quarter mile according to tests done back in the day......
-
Are you sure you weren't riding your 1st gen?!! R/T for first run is not bad, would have liked to see numbers for the 4th run. For those that don't know, here in the states a reaction time (last yellow to green light take off) of 4/100ths of a second (.040) is considered perfect, hard to achieve. Me thinks more practice is in order, along with a clean track........... Glad you had fun, though, thats the idea in the first place. MkII rear suspension rods
Dano replied to frankd's topic in Venture and Venture Royale Tech Talk ('83 - '93)
The MKII's have flat spots on the links which are ideal spots to drill, tap and install zerk fittings to service in the future. Your bushings may be shot now that the bolts are seized to them, they are a fabric/hard cover type deal. Pull them out and clean them up good, along with liberal lubrication when reinstalling them should help in the future. Good luck, Dan -
